Learning outcomes

After successful completion of the course, students are able to perform experiments around a research reactor in the fields of neutron flux, reactivity and reactor period as well as to explain the origin of Xenon poisoning and to describe reactivity effects.

 

 

Subject of course

Totally 12 experiments are carried out in groups of maximal 4 students:

  1. Thermal flux
  2. Fast flux
  3. Void coefficient
  4. Danger coefficient
  5. Reactivity
  6. Cross section
  7. Critical experiment
  8. Rod calibration
  9. Subcritical multiplication
  10. Reactivity values of fuel rods
  11. Power calibration
  12. Transient operation up to 250 MW

Teaching methods

During the laboratory tutorial students operate experiments (activation of foils, measurements of radioactive samples,…) and furthermore calculate the results based on tables.
